HANDOVER NOTE — Commercial Director

To my successor: the revised commission scheme for the Ostermark sales group is drafted, not yet announced. Key changes: accelerators kick in at 110% of quota, clawbacks extend to six months, and multi-year deals pay on booked annual value only. Legal has cleared the terms. Regional leads have not been briefed — hold that until board sign-off. Rollout deck is in the shared drive. One confidential point sits below.

board note of tadup-tajog: Headcount on the Oliiel team goes from 31 to 88 by the end of February. Gross margin on Oliiel came in at 62 percent against a plan of 29 percent.

No. The Lanternfold schema registry enforces backward compatibility on every merge to the event catalog. Your job as reviewer is to confirm the change is semantically sensible: field names follow the catalog conventions, deprecated fields are marked rather than deleted, and the version bump matches the change type. If the registry check fails, the author must resolve it before review continues. Compatibility rules, version policy, and escalation steps are documented on the internal page below:

operations page: https://confluence.qorvellabs.internal/pages/projects/projects/projects

**Handover — Brushfire orphan sweeper**

Taking over from me on the Brushfire sweeper: it walks the Cloudmere inventory every four hours and deletes resources with no live owner tag. Two cautions. First, the dry-run flag must stay on in staging — people prototype there without tags and will be cross if you delete their work. Second, the deletion quota per run is deliberately low; raise it only with a change record. If a sweep hangs, restart the worker rather than killing mid-batch. Its current production configuration is as follows.

service settings:
WENATH_PIN=5007
WENATH_METRICS_HOST=metrics.wenath.tolvaqlabs.corp
WENATH_LOG_LEVEL=debug
WENATH_TENANT=rusox